Dataframe loc 条件选取
WebJan 17, 2024 · df.loc [ ( (df.A == 1) (df.A == 2)) & ( (df.B == 600) (df.B == 200)), "C"] = "1or2and600or200" You can also proceed with .isin for more clear and concise picture as referred by @AndrewF df.loc [df.A.isin ( [1, 2]) & df.B.isin ( [600, 200]), 'C'] = "1or2and600or200" WebThe loc property gets, or sets, the value (s) of the specified labels. Specify both row and column with a label. To access more than one row, use double brackets and specify the labels, separated by commas: df.loc [ ["Sally", "John"]] Specify columns by including their labels in another list: df.loc [ ["Sally", "John"], ["age", "qualified"]]
Dataframe loc 条件选取
Did you know?
WebPandas DataFrame是帶有標簽軸(行和列)的二維大小可變的,可能是異構的表格數據結構。算術運算在行和列標簽上對齊。可以將其視為Series對象的dict-like容器。這是 Pandas … WebMay 30, 2024 · 选取多列一定是 两个 方括号,其中内侧方括号代表是一个list: image image 如果要选择某列等于多个数值或者字符串时,要用到.isin (), 我们把df修改了一下( isin …
WebDec 4, 2024 · 采用df.loc [],df.iloc [],df.ix []这三种方法进行数据选取时,方括号内必须有两个参数,第一个参数是对行的筛选条件,第二个参数是对列的筛选条件,两个参数用逗 … WebDec 20, 2024 · Python— Pandas 之i loc 、 loc. qq_45986917的博客. 460. 目录 一、 loc 二、i loc Python除了最基本的 筛选 外,例:data [‘A’] 还有 loc 、i loc 、ix(已不推荐使 …
WebPython pandas.DataFrame.loc用法及代碼示例 用法: property DataFrame. loc 通過標簽或布爾數組訪問一組行和列。 .loc [] 主要基於標簽,但也可以與布爾數組一起使用。 允許的輸入是: 單個標簽,例如 5 或者 'a' , (注意 5 被解釋為 標簽 的 index ,和 絕不 作為沿索引的整數位置)。 標簽列表或數組,例如['a', 'b', 'c'] 。 帶有標簽的切片對象,例如'a':'f' 。 警 … WebFeb 21, 2024 · pandas的DataFrame对象,本质上是 二维矩阵 ,跟常规二维矩阵的差别在于前者额外指定了每一行和每一列的 名称 。. 这样内部数据抽取既可以用“ 行列名称(对 …
Web如何在pandas的DataFrame中插入一行? (Python) - 问答 - 腾讯云开发者社区-腾讯云
Webproperty DataFrame.loc [source] #. Access a group of rows and columns by label (s) or a boolean array. .loc [] is primarily label based, but may also be used with a boolean array. … Notes. agg is an alias for aggregate.Use the alias. Functions that mutate the passed … pandas.DataFrame.insert - pandas.DataFrame.loc — pandas 2.0.0 … pandas.DataFrame.isin# DataFrame. isin (values) [source] # Whether each … DataFrame.loc. Label-location based indexer for selection by label. … pandas.DataFrame.ndim - pandas.DataFrame.loc — pandas 2.0.0 … Get item from object for given key (ex: DataFrame column). Series.at. Access a … pandas.DataFrame.iat - pandas.DataFrame.loc — pandas 2.0.0 … Use the index from the left DataFrame as the join key(s). If it is a MultiIndex, the … pandas.DataFrame.groupby - pandas.DataFrame.loc — pandas 2.0.0 … Alternatively, use a mapping, e.g. {col: dtype, …}, where col is a column label … cabinet between two windows kitchenWebFeb 17, 2024 · 您好,关于 pandas dataframe 的多 条件筛选 ,可以使用 loc 函数进 行筛选 。 例如,假设有一个名为 df 的 dataframe ,需要 筛选 出列 A 大于 10,列 B 等于 'foo',列 C 不等于 'bar' 的 行 ,可以使用以下代码: df.loc [ (df ['A'] > 10) & (df ['B'] == 'foo') & (df ['C'] != 'bar')] 希望能对您有所帮助。 “相关推荐”对你有帮助么? 非常没帮助 没帮助 一般 有帮 … cabinet bex mon compteWebMay 21, 2024 · 利用DataFrame.iloc []和DataFrame.loc []筛选特定数据(多条件筛选)_dataframe.loc多条件_fgggcgg的博客-CSDN博客 利用DataFrame.iloc [] … clownfish \u0026amp sea anemone